Okay gamer’s out there who have felt left out with the Starcraft II craze are now given the opportunity to play the game for free! Yep, that’s right, Blizzard is giving South East Asia (SEA) players the opportunity to play SCII over the weekend! The free play would start at 00:00 on November 19 and ends at 23:59 on November 21.
If you’re a new player and don’t have a Battle.net account you can create them on this link and activate StarCraft II on your account. However, if you have an existing Bnet account but do no thave SCII, you can still participate and activate the game for the free-play weekend. You have to remember though that you need a working internet connection to take part in the free-play weekend.
According to Blizzard, the free-play weekend also marks the availability of the pre-paid game-time card for players in Hong Kong/Macau, Indonesia, Malaysia, the Philippines, Singapore, and Thailand. The cards come in 3-day, 7-day, and 30-day increments. To know more about the pricing and the cards themselves you can visit the post regarding the pre-paid pricing.
